屋面雨水水质及其收集回用技术分析

【摘要】 屋面雨水是一种可供回收利用的水资源,探究了屋面雨水水质及屋面材料、雨前干期和空气质量对水质的影响。结果表明,雨水中的污染物主要来自下垫面,以油毡屋面污染最重,雨前干期时间越长,屋面雨水水质越差。利用雨水花园对屋面雨水进行收集和预处理后储存在水箱中,储存在水箱中的各项指标因为沉降作用和微生物作用存在竖向差异,污染物浓度会逐渐下降,微生物数量会逐渐增加;降雨会带来储存水箱中浊度、TN、TP和耗氧量的升高,菌落总数由于稀释作用反而下降。储存在水箱中的雨水经过超滤膜过滤后,检测的几项指标可达到分散式生活饮用水卫生标准。

【Abstract】 Roof rainwater was a water resource that could be reclaimed for use.In this study,influence of roof materials,rain free period and air quality on roof rainwater quality were explored.The results showed that pollutants in rainwater were mainly from the underlying surface.The most polluted rain water was from linoleum roof,and the longer the rain free period,the worse the roof rainwater quality.Roof rainwater was collected and pretreated by a rainwater garden and then stored in a water tank.Quality of water stored in the tank exhibited vertical differences due to sedimentation and microbial action.Concentration of pollutants decreased and microorganisms increased over time.Rainfall increased the turbidity,TN,TP and oxygen consumption of water in the tank,and the total number of colonies decreased due to dilution.Several quality indexes of the water stored in the tank were tested and could meet the hygienic standard of decentralized drinking water after filtered by the ultrafiltration membrane.
